Freeman v. Wolff

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of New York, Second Department
Jan 1, 1933
237 App. Div. 897 (N.Y. App. Div. 1933)

Opinion

January, 1933.

Present — Lazansky, P.J., Kapper, Carswell, Scudder and Davis, JJ.


Motion to dismiss appeal denied on condition that appellant perfect the appeal for the February term (for which term the case is set down) and be ready for argument when reached; otherwise, motion granted, with ten dollars costs.
